Levi's® Double Horse patch, embossed with "May 20, 1873," commemorates the patent acquisition day for Levi's. With every revolution around the sun, this date is celebrated by Levi's as an important day.

This year, Hong Kong Levi's held "The 150 Hong Kong Stories of 501" exhibition at Parallel Space on May 26 to 28, in celebration of the 150th anniversary of the brand’s iconic staple – the Levi’s 501 jeans.

Hong Kong’s 150 enthusiasts sending their birthday regards, included individuals from various fields such as music, art, rap, fashion, vintage clothing, dance, and design students. These enthusiasts, including Eric Kot, MC Yan, Rubberband, KOLOR, Wong Yat Ho, CHANKA, Jason Kui, JB, The Hertz, Dorothy Lau, IPYI, Ma Li, and LOUSY, have contributed to the exhibition by showcasing their historical treasures and artistic creations inspired by 501.

Hong Kong’s leading fashion enthusiasts and artists were plastered against the walls of the lowest floor of the exhibition wearing their Levi’s – here were some of The Beat Asia’s favourite stylings.

Captivating Stories of 150 Individuals

The exhibition also showcased captivating stories of 150 individuals from Hong Kong and their connection to the iconic 501® jeans. The exhibits include:

Horace Tsui's denim artwork skilfully mirroring the headshot of Eric Kot

A museum-grade antique pair of Levi's work pants, produced between 1873 and 1874, with rivet marks and design structure confirming it as one of Levi's earliest products, owned by collector Gary.

Designer Sonic Lam's refurbished 90s Levi's Vintage Clothing pair of jeans, blending two elements from the 90s—children's handkerchiefs and a Mickey Mouse T-shirt—to create the "Freaky Mouse Jeans".

Vintage clothing collector Gary Kwan's 60s pair of 501 jeans, cut into shorts, and transformed by adding 1980s 501 jeans and modern Kaihara Mills denim fabric, resulting in the "Tri-Colour" jeans that symbolize a perfect fusion of the past, present, and future.
